How Holly Ridge compares
By median home value, Holly Ridge is the 1st most expensive of 5 cities in Onslow County, and its typical home is worth more than 86% of all homes in Onslow County.
Home values in Holly Ridge
Share of homes at each estimated value.
| # | Onslow County | Median value | Homes |
|---|---|---|---|
| 1 | Holly Ridge | $454K | 5,569 |
| 2 | Swansboro | $387K | 5,285 |
| 3 | Richlands | $266K | 7,742 |
| 4 | Jacksonville | $260K | 34,228 |
| 5 | Maysville | $211K | 2,555 |
About the Holly Ridge market
What is the median home price in Holly Ridge, NC?
The median sale price in Holly Ridge, NC is $389,000 (data through July 2026), based on deeds recorded with the county. That is up 9.1% from a year earlier.
How many homes sell in Holly Ridge, NC each year?
332 homes sold in Holly Ridge, NC over the last 12 months (data through July 2026). TopHap counts recorded arm's-length deeds, not listings, so the figure is not affected by which brokerage handled the sale.
Is Holly Ridge, NC a buyer's or seller's market?
Holly Ridge, NC is currently a seller's market, scoring 64 out of 100 on TopHap's market temperature index (data through July 2026). The score weighs sales velocity and price direction; above 60 favours sellers, below 40 favours buyers.
How many homes are there in Holly Ridge, NC?
Holly Ridge, NC contains 5,569 residential properties, with a median of 1,640 square feet, 3 bedrooms, built around 2011. The median TopHap Estimate is $454K.
How does Holly Ridge, NC compare to the rest of Onslow County?
By median home value, Holly Ridge, NC is the 1st most expensive of 5 cities in Onslow County. Its typical home is worth more than 86% of all homes in Onslow County. Swansboro just below. The ranking is rebuilt nightly from the county assessor record of every home in each area.
Do people own or rent in Holly Ridge, NC?
54% of homes in Holly Ridge, NC are owner-occupied. 13% are held by a company rather than an individual.
How much equity do owners in Holly Ridge, NC hold?
53% of mortgaged homes in Holly Ridge, NC are equity-rich, meaning the loan balance is under half the home's value. 0.9% owe more than the home is worth.
